Teaching in Saudi Arabia; I don’t pay rent or bills, there’s been a big improvement in my finances – Ghanaian shares

Paul Dramani, a Ghanaian based in Saudi Arabia shared some of the benefits he enjoys as a teacher in the Middle East.

In a chat on Daily Hustle Worldwide, Paul disclosed that he quit his teaching job in Ghana because he saw no improvement in his life. As a result, he travelled to Saudi Arabia to work and researched the opportunities available for international teachers.

According to Paul, he applied for a teaching job and got it with his qualifications from Ghana. He said on the benefits and salary, “The employer provides accommodation and transportation for free and I get a tax-free salary. I also enjoy free health insurance and my salary is better than my previous job here.”

“There has been a tremendous improvement in my finances. I sometimes wonder how long it would have taken to make GHS10,000 in Ghana. I’m very comfortable here now and believe it was a good decision to come here,” he said on SVTV AFRICA.

Moreover, Mr Dramani added that the employer also applies and provides his work permit. He advised others to research as international schools in Saudi Arabia often employ teachers worldwide.
